Methyl 2-O-allyl-3-O-benzyl-4,6-O-benzylidene-α-D-mannopyranoside

  • CAS No.: 210297-54-4
  • Formula:C24H28O6
  • Molecular Weight:412.48

IUPAC Name: (4aR,6S,7S,8S,8aR)-7-(allyloxy)-8-(benzyloxy)-6-methoxy-2-phenylhexahydropyrano[3,2-d][1,3]dioxine

InChIKey: YFGKDDPSSKUWEG-NBOVQHNFSA-N

SMILES: CO[C@H]([C@H]1OCC=C)O[C@@](COC(C2=CC=CC=C2)O3)([H])[C@]3([H])[C@@H]1OCC4=CC=CC=C4

Biological Activity: Methyl 2-O-allyl-3-O-benzyl-4,6-O-benzylidene-α-D-mannopyranoside is a class of biochemical reagents used in glycobiology research. Glycobiology studies the structure, synthesis, biology, and evolution of sugars. It involves carbohydrate chemistry, enzymology of glycan formation and degradation, protein-glycan recognition, and the role of glycans in biological systems. This field is closely related to basic research, biomedicine, and biotechnology[1].
